How long is Odyssey 100%?

When focusing on the main objectives, Assassin's Creed Odyssey is about 45½ Hours in length. If you're a gamer that strives to see all aspects of the game, you are likely to spend around 143 Hours to obtain 100% completion.

How many endings does Odyssey have?

There are nine possible ways that Assassin's Creed: Odyssey can end (more specifically, nine ways its cultist plot can end). Which one you receive is determined by how many of your character's family members you saved during the course of the campaign.

How do you get the secret ending in Assassin's Creed Odyssey?

Let Nikolaos Live - During the Wolf of Sparta quest in Chapter 2, you have the option to kill Nikolaos. However, to get the best ending in Assassin's Creed Odyssey, you'll have to forgive the man who once tried to kill you, and let him live.

What level is Medusa AC Odyssey?

As reported by GamesRadar, players must reach at least level 46 to unlock the Medusa quest. However, achieving the highest level of 50 will give the character the best chance to defeat Medusa, as all her warriors are level 50 as well.

How many years does AC Odyssey span?

The game's plot tells a mythological history of the Peloponnesian War between Athens and Sparta from 431 to 422 BC.

What happens when you fail a quest in Odyssey?

There's no sync in Odyssey, so if you fail a mission it likely means there is nothing further to progress to afterwards and it won't lock you out of experiencing anything else later on. I'd recommend to load a previous save as soon as you fail a mission if you would like to complete it though.
